Fabien Potencier
dd158a2c99
[Console] made CommandTester::getDispaly() work even in case of an error during execution
2011-04-03 23:25:59 +02:00
Francis Besset
97729e6c61
Updated XSD schema
2011-04-03 23:08:56 +02:00
Francis Besset
9b093d53ae
Moved hydrators configuration in entity manager
2011-04-03 23:08:18 +02:00
Francis Besset
daa138ffc8
[DoctrineBundle] Added custom hydrator for the EntityManager from configuration
2011-04-03 22:39:35 +02:00
Fabien Potencier
ad4a0bda1c
[Console] changed returned value of CommandTester to the command exit code
2011-04-03 22:30:40 +02:00
Fabien Potencier
91a2f36850
[DomCrawler] fixed typo in phpdoc
2011-04-03 22:23:52 +02:00
Jordi Boggiano
21b3ee6783
[WebProfilerBundle] Prevent redirects to be intercepted in XHRs
2011-04-03 21:21:23 +02:00
Jordi Boggiano
a16f1865b5
[WebProfilerBundle] Display errors logged by monolog properly in logger panel
2011-04-03 16:36:04 +02:00
Jordi Boggiano
7132f81d14
[Serializer] Some more privates
2011-04-03 16:24:25 +02:00
Jordi Boggiano
47733d08a1
[Serializer] Move private methods below protected ones
2011-04-03 16:21:53 +02:00
Jordi Boggiano
54ffb1fbc0
[Serializer] Added @api annotations
2011-04-03 15:49:40 +02:00
Jordi Boggiano
507f6269b5
[Serializer] Added docblocks for NormalizableInterface
2011-04-03 15:44:09 +02:00
Jordi Boggiano
76cab7deb9
[Serializer] add methods to the SerializerInterface
2011-04-03 15:15:53 +02:00
Jordi Boggiano
cb727dbde3
[Serializer] Added docblock
2011-04-03 15:14:07 +02:00
Jordi Boggiano
424a1dad27
[Serializer] Switched most protected to private or final
2011-04-03 15:13:21 +02:00
Fabien Pennequin
34c6dbf5d2
Updated file UPDATE.md for assetic filters
2011-04-03 12:04:31 +02:00
Victor Berchet
788ed5126b
[FrameworkBundle] Fix the cache template loader
2011-04-02 19:18:32 +02:00
Fabien Potencier
5d143c4aac
Merge remote branch 'weaverryan/prevent_exception_on_handle_exception'
...
* weaverryan/prevent_exception_on_handle_exception:
[HttpKernel] Wrapping the end of handleException() in a try-catch to prevent response listeners from throwing another exception
2011-04-02 18:40:34 +02:00
Fabien Potencier
53274512e2
Merge remote branch 'weaverryan/better_import_exception_and_bug_fix'
...
* weaverryan/better_import_exception_and_bug_fix:
[Config] Improving the exception when a resource cannot be imported
[DependencyInjection] Fixing a bug where "ignore_errors" doesn't work in YAML and XML
2011-04-02 18:37:51 +02:00
Fabien Potencier
e92ac9eeef
Merge remote branch 'weaverryan/exception_page_changes'
...
* weaverryan/exception_page_changes:
[FrameworkBundle] When there are multiple nested exceptions, this hides the stacktrace from all exceptions by default
[FrameworkBundle] Fixing small bug on exception page where the +/- icons didn't toggle correctly
2011-04-02 18:33:55 +02:00
Bernhard Schussek
72a41f8c94
[Form] Fixed: Booleans can be used as choice keys now
2011-04-02 18:26:28 +02:00
Fabien Potencier
1cd9b5bb49
Merge remote branch 'kriswallsmith/assetic/updates'
...
* kriswallsmith/assetic/updates:
[AsseticBundle] added twig support for asset packages
[AsseticBundle] cleaned up php templating support
[FrameworkBundle] fixed interface and usage in RouterHelper
[AsseticBundle] fixed twig classes for api changes in assetic
2011-04-02 18:15:45 +02:00
Fabien Potencier
0667e706fe
Merge remote branch 'kriswallsmith/assetic/config-fixes'
...
* kriswallsmith/assetic/config-fixes:
[AsseticBundle] moved some parameter defaults to Configuration
[AsseticBundle] fixed definition of filter configs
2011-04-02 18:15:43 +02:00
Fabien Potencier
336a184bb4
Merge remote branch 'kriswallsmith/assetic/coalesce-dirs'
...
* kriswallsmith/assetic/coalesce-dirs:
[AsseticBundle] added coalescing directory resources that check the kernel for bundle templates
2011-04-02 18:15:41 +02:00
Bernhard Schussek
a5d0b3aea6
[Form] Changed FormBuilder::set(Client|Norm)Transformer to FormBuilder::prepend(Client|Norm)Transformer and FormBuilder::append(Client|Norm)Transformer to facilitate extension of types
2011-04-02 16:39:19 +02:00
Victor Berchet
5e141402e1
[WebProfilerBundle] Fix the intercept_redirects option
2011-04-02 16:13:08 +02:00
Victor Berchet
ac03440d7a
[WebProfilerBundle] Make wdtb verbosity configurable
2011-04-02 16:13:08 +02:00
Victor Berchet
b2be041475
[WebProfilerBundle] Remove the format and content type from the wdtb
2011-04-02 16:13:07 +02:00
Bernhard Schussek
be9ef42af9
[Form] Renamed choice transformers for better clarity
2011-04-02 16:11:20 +02:00
Bernhard Schussek
fc59936740
[Form] Fixed: ThemeRenderer::isChoiceSelected() works correctly for boolean choices
2011-04-02 16:00:46 +02:00
Bernhard Schussek
a4bbc40ac6
[Form] Cleaned up ChoiceListInterface
2011-04-02 15:41:43 +02:00
Pascal Borreli
8a82aee56f
[Locale][Windows] Fixing tests for old ICU version (default in php.net packages)
2011-04-02 13:19:30 +00:00
Bernhard Schussek
d3b7c4e8c1
[Form] Moved getLabel(), isChoiceSelected() and isChoiceGroup() from ChoiceListInterface to ThemeRenderer
2011-04-02 14:14:18 +02:00
Bernhard Schussek
d3c8647f49
[Form] Fixed EntitiesToArrayTransformer::reverseTransform() to accept NULL values
2011-04-02 14:13:16 +02:00
Ryan Weaver
39f81753ce
[FrameworkBundle] When there are multiple nested exceptions, this hides the stacktrace from all exceptions by default
...
This addresses the potential issue where a user doesn't realize that there are multiple exception messages because the
full stack trace of the first exception is displayed (pushing the others far far down the page). This hides the stacktrace
of all exceptions (when there are more than one) by default, making each exception message easily viewable.
2011-04-02 06:25:34 -05:00
Ryan Weaver
a166b8de64
[FrameworkBundle] Fixing small bug on exception page where the +/- icons didn't toggle correctly
2011-04-02 06:24:00 -05:00
Bernhard Schussek
94f2baa895
[Form] Fixed BooleanToStringTransformer::reverseTransform() to accept NULL values. Fixes ChoiceTypeTest
2011-04-02 13:00:19 +02:00
Bernhard Schussek
37e8e1270c
[Form][FrameworkBundle][TwigBundle] Renamed view variable 'disabled' to 'read_only' to match with the according FormInterface methods
2011-04-02 12:18:43 +02:00
Bernhard Schussek
39b0aafc00
Merge remote branch 'symfony/master' into experimental
...
Conflicts:
src/Symfony/Bundle/DoctrineBundle/Resources/config/orm.xml
2011-04-02 12:08:27 +02:00
Bernhard Schussek
35d9b7f800
[Form] Improved test coverage of Form. The emptyValue closure now receives the Form instance to use form data when constructing new objects
2011-04-02 12:00:19 +02:00
Bernhard Schussek
4f39234741
[Form] bind() is ignored if a form is read-only
2011-04-02 11:39:15 +02:00
Bernhard Schussek
ca20aef379
[Form] Improved test coverage of DelegatingValidator and fixed validation group inheritance
2011-04-02 11:35:58 +02:00
Bernhard Schussek
33b0011f86
[Form] Improved test coverage of Form
2011-04-02 11:22:29 +02:00
Fabien Potencier
1d4024c654
[Process] added some missing accessors/mutators
2011-04-02 10:08:01 +02:00
Kris Wallsmith
06074c367d
[AsseticBundle] added twig support for asset packages
2011-04-01 20:59:24 -07:00
Kris Wallsmith
e6d4734d4e
[AsseticBundle] cleaned up php templating support
2011-04-01 20:59:24 -07:00
Kris Wallsmith
6c3f50a585
[FrameworkBundle] fixed interface and usage in RouterHelper
2011-04-01 20:58:17 -07:00
michaelwilliams
46b711c4a8
Update PDO session storage to check if any rows are updated when doing a session write. If no rows are udpated when performing a session write it generally means that we have created a new session id somewhere and we have not inserted into the database. This is the case for when calling regenerate_session_id() from the native session storage class. It will update the session id then call sessionWrite() to save the session but since the new session id does not exist in the DB, no rows are updated and any new session attributes such as security tokens are lost.
...
See http://www.php.net/manual/en/function.session-set-save-handler.php#103055 for more details
2011-04-01 18:14:27 -07:00
Ryan Weaver
b9883a3bad
[Config] Improving the exception when a resource cannot be imported
...
This improves, for example, the exception one would receive if they tried to import a resource from a bundle that doesn't exist.
Previously, the deep "bundle is not activated" exception would be thrown. That has value, however there is no indication of where
the exception is actually occurring.
In this new implementation, we throw an exception that explains exactly which resource, and from which source resource, cannot be
loaded. The deeper exception is still thrown as a nested exception.
Two caveats:
* The `HttpKernel::varToString` method was replicated
* This introduces a new `Exception` class, which allows us to prevent lot's of exceptions from nesting into each other in the case
that some deeply imported resource cannot be imported (each upstream import that fails doesn't add its own exception).
2011-04-01 18:59:54 -05:00
Ryan Weaver
65ac5ec7c0
[DependencyInjection] Fixing a bug where "ignore_errors" doesn't work in YAML and XML
...
Tests added, the arguments were simply mismatched.
2011-04-01 18:59:45 -05:00